Abstract

The paper presents the results of mathematical modeling of the interaction of shock waves with water barriers. The equations of gas dynamics supplemented by taking into account the presence of dispersed water in the flow and its settling on the walls of the mine workings are used as a mathematical model. An approach has been developed to implement a method for solving the problem of the propagation of shock waves in a branched network of mine workings, taking into account the interaction of shock waves with water barriers. The approach is based on the use of the numerical method of S.K. Godunov. Examples of solving the problem of the propagation of shock waves from a methane explosion in model networks of coal mine workings with water barriers placed in them are given.
